The same government report that announced 339,000 new jobs in May also announced 440,000 new unemployed persons, causing unemployment to rise from 3.4 to 3.7%. Since the labor participation rate did not change, both cannot be true.

The number of Americans applying for unemployment benefits last week jumped to its highest level since October 2021, even as the labor market remains one of the healthiest parts of the U.S. economy. cbsn.ws/3Ct6aBf
